  • Abstract
    A train of fundamental solitons at 1.53 mu m has been generated, with pulse durations of 1.5-3.0 ps, at a repetition rate in the range 80-130 GHz from the output of two CW single mode DFB lasers amplified in an Er-doped fibre. The transformation of the beat signal into a soliton train resulted from nonlinear propagation of the signal in a special fibre with dispersion decreasing along the length.
